Young Chefs Academy hosts open houses

By Gracie Bonds Staples
Aug 12, 2015

Young Chefs Academy, a local favorite for children’s cooking classes that encourages discovery and creativity, will host “Back to School” open house events at its two metro Atlanta locations this fall in partnership with Food Network Magazine.

Children and their parents are invited to explore their creative culinary sides and participate in unique cooking experiences during each event. Sponsored by the California Grape Board, Sara Lee and Horizon Organic Milk, the event will allow children to create back-to-school snack recipes, learn kitchen safety tips, enjoy samples and win fun prizes.

Representatives from Young Chefs Academy will be on hand to discuss classes and curriculum, special events and programs with interested parents

The events, set for Aug. 29 at the North Druid Hills location and Sept. 20 on Hammond Drive in Sandy Springs, will feature fun learning stations, giveaways, and will highlight the courses and events Young Chefs Academy can offer to Atlanta-area children.

Both open houses run from 1 p.m. to 3 p.m.
